The term refers to a person who favors government control of businesses that affects most citizens is POPULIST.

A populist person is someone who cares about the interests and opinions of ordinary people rather than a small group.

Trump expresses one aspect of populism, which is anger at the establishment and various elites. He believes Americans have been betrayed by those elites.

The term “populism” dates to the 1890s, when America’s Populist movement pitted rural populations and the Democratic Party against the more urban Republicans.

In the 1950s journalists began applying it more broadly to describe everything from fascist and communist movements in Europe to America’s anti-communist McCarthyites and Argentina’s Peronistas.
